About This Book

Jessica sneaks through the crowded gym, eyes fixed on Todd Wilkins, the star basketball player everyone admires. She’s determined to win his heart — even if it means betraying her own twin sister Elizabeth. But what happens when secrets start to unravel?

Quick Assessment

This young adult novel centers on twin sisters Jessica and Elizabeth, exploring themes of teenage romance and sibling rivalry set in a high school environment. Appropriate for ages 13-18, the story deals with social issues typical of adolescence, including jealousy and competition. Parents should note the focus on interpersonal conflict but find no explicit content.
